1. Introduction to Minimal Bets in Gaming: Concept and Significance

a. Defining minimal bets and their role in modern gaming ecosystems

Minimal bets refer to the smallest wager allowed within a game, often designed to lower the entry barrier for players. These low-stakes options are integral to contemporary gaming platforms, facilitating increased accessibility and encouraging prolonged engagement. By enabling players to participate without risking large sums, minimal bets foster a more inclusive environment that appeals to a broad demographic, including casual gamers and newcomers.

b. Historical evolution from high-stakes to low-stakes gaming

Historically, gambling was predominantly associated with high-stakes bets, often involving significant sums of money. Over time, technological advancements and regulatory shifts led to the rise of low-stakes gaming, especially with the advent of online casinos and mobile apps. This transition aimed to mitigate risk, promote responsible gambling, and expand the market to more diverse audiences.

c. Why understanding minimal bets is crucial for players and developers

For players, grasping the concept of minimal bets helps in managing risk and making informed choices, especially in free-to-play or microtransaction-based environments. Developers benefit by designing engaging, responsible gaming experiences that comply with regulations, foster trust, and optimize revenue models. A nuanced understanding of minimal betting mechanics supports the creation of sustainable gaming ecosystems.

2. The Psychology of Betting: How Minimal Bets Influence Player Behavior

a. Risk perception and decision-making at low bet levels

At minimal bet levels, players often perceive lower risk, which encourages experimentation and repeated play. This perception can lead to increased engagement, as players feel less threatened by potential losses. Psychological studies indicate that small bets activate reward pathways in the brain similarly to larger bets, reinforcing continued participation.

b. The role of minimal bets in encouraging sustained engagement

Minimal bets serve as an entry point for players to develop familiarity with game mechanics without substantial financial commitment. This low-stakes environment fosters habituation, where players are more likely to return and explore further, ultimately increasing lifetime engagement and potential monetization.

c. Non-obvious psychological effects, such as perceived value and habituation

Beyond risk perception, minimal bets influence perceptions of value and fairness. When players see low-cost options, they may feel they are getting more entertainment per dollar spent, reinforcing positive associations. Over time, habituation to low bets reduces decision anxiety, making players more comfortable with increasing stakes gradually.

3. Economic and Regulatory Perspectives on Minimal Bets

a. How minimal bets shape revenue models for casinos and online platforms

From an economic standpoint, minimal bets can generate steady revenue streams through volume rather than high individual stakes. Online platforms leverage microtransactions, where players place numerous small bets, cumulatively increasing overall income. This model benefits from lower barriers to entry, attracting casual players who may upgrade to higher stakes over time.

b. Regulatory considerations and responsible gambling measures

Regulators worldwide emphasize protecting vulnerable players, leading to policies that promote responsible gambling. Many jurisdictions mandate limits on minimal bets and implement features like self-exclusion and deposit caps. These measures are designed to prevent addiction while maintaining the economic benefits of low-stake gaming.

c. Cultural differences in attitudes toward low-stake betting, referencing Asian casino practices with the number 8

Cultural perceptions significantly influence betting behaviors. For instance, in many Asian cultures, the number 8 symbolizes prosperity and good fortune, leading to favorable attitudes toward gambling involving this number. Casinos in regions like Macau often incorporate such symbolism to attract players, and low-bet options with culturally significant numbers are common, reflecting local preferences and beliefs.

6. From Penny Slots to Advanced Gaming Security: The Spectrum of Minimal Bets

a. Evolution from traditional penny slots to complex digital gaming security systems

Traditional penny slots introduced the concept of low-cost gaming, paving the way for sophisticated digital security systems that protect low-bet environments today. Modern platforms employ multi-layered security measures, including encryption, biometric verification, and fraud detection, to ensure fairness and safety at minimal wager levels.

b. The importance of minimal bets in fostering responsible gambling practices

Allowing players to wager small amounts supports responsible gambling by enabling risk management and reducing potential harm. Developers incorporate features like betting limits and self-exclusion options, aligning with responsible gaming guidelines and promoting sustainable participation.

c. How security measures adapt to support low-bet gaming environments without compromising fairness

Adaptive security protocols ensure that low-bet games remain fair and transparent. Techniques such as provably fair algorithms and blockchain technology are increasingly utilized to verify outcomes and prevent manipulation, fostering trust among players engaging in minimal stake betting.
